Design and Display: The Oppo 8 Pro features a sleek and elegant design, with reasonably limited metal frame and a glass back. It features a 6.7-inch AMOLED display with a solution of 1440 x 3216 pixels, offering vivid and sharp visuals. The display also supports a 120Hz refresh rate, providing smooth and fluid scrolling and animation.
Performance and Battery Life: The Oppo 8 Pro is powered with a Qualcomm Snapdragon 888 processor, in conjunction with 12GB of RAM and 256GB of internal storage. It delivers fast and responsive performance, allowing users to multitask, run demanding apps and games, and navigate the device with ease. The device also features a 4500mAh battery with support for fast charging and wireless charging, providing ample battery life to last through the day.
Camera Features: The Oppo 8 Pro boasts a quad-camera setup, including a 50MP primary sensor, a 50MP ultra-wide sensor, a 13MP telephoto lens, and a 3MP microlens. The camera system offers impressive zoom capabilities, as much as 60x magnification, and advanced features such as for instance 10-bit color capture and HDR video recording. The front-facing camera is just a 32MP sensor, providing high-quality selfies and video calls.
Software and User Experience: The Oppo 8 Pro runs on ColorOS 11.2, based on Android 11, offering a smooth and intuitive user experience. The device also has an in-display fingerprint scanner, face unlock, and other advanced features such as for instance dual-mode 5G connectivity and Wi-Fi 6 support.
